When I was younger and thinner I went into Abercrombie and tried on a pair of shorts in an 8. They were cute with bows (I’m a sucker for a bow) but they left little to the imagination for what kind of underwear I might be wearing. Not being comfortable having shorts at my underwear line I thought maybe if I size up they will sit lower on the hip. I asked the sales girl if they had that in a size 10 and I got this reply “oh we don't carry that item in a size 10...could you imagine how bad that would look. We don't cater to the obese. Besides those fit you fine". I promptly left. Recently the CEO of Abercrombie has come under fire for his comments: With such comments you would think that I would boycott Abercrombie. Nope just the opposite. Oh I’m not going to give them any more business but I do own some Abercrombie stuff. I own a few size 10 jeans that I can squeeze into.
